Brake line replacement costs vary between vehicles, but you can expect to spend anywhere between $5 and $220. Brake hose replacement costs between $165 and $200 on average. Here, the rubber lines normally cost around $150 to replace and the steel lines bolted. Brake lines are flexible tubes that connect the brake caliper. Synchrony states that in general, replacing a brake line costs around $150 to $300 per hose. Service, parts, cost & recommendations from yourmechanic. Generally, you can expect to pay. Labor costs can range from $80 to $250. Nubrakes estimates that brake line repair costs range from $150 to $550, depending on the extent of damage, line type, and labor required. The cost of replacing your hydraulic brake hose will vary depending on the make and model of your car, the type of hose your vehicle uses, its manufacturer, and where you live.
